Assisting Relationships (Mentoring)

Assisting Relationship (Targeted Mentoring) Services
Street Whyze provides targeted 1:1 and group Assisting Relationship sessions to schools and educational establishments. This approach goes beyond traditional mentoring by offering a deeper, more holistic level of support. Sessions focus on key areas including aspirations, attitude to learning, identity, relationships, personal safety, positive use of time, and engagement in education.
Fully integrated within school settings, the service is designed to help students re-engage with learning and get back on track. Each programme is outcome-focused and delivered over half-term or full-term durations to ensure measurable and sustained impact.
Integrated Alternative Povision - ELEVATE

Elevate – Integrated Alternative Provision
Elevate is Street Whyze’s innovative, school-based Alternative Provision designed to work in close partnership with educational settings. It offers bespoke teaching in core GCSE subjects, complemented by the development of essential life and social skills. The programme is fully integrated within the school environment, ensuring continuity of learning and alignment with each student’s wider educational plan. Elevate prioritises engagement, progress, and positive outcomes, supporting schools to reduce exclusions and re-engage learners in meaningful education that prepares them for future success.
Knife Crime & Youth Violence

Knife Crime & Negative Youth Culture Sessions
Street Whyze delivers a distinctive and impactful session on knife crime and negative youth culture. Unlike the traditional storytelling assemblies that many young people have become desensitised to — and which often fail to create lasting impact — this session takes a fresh, evidence-informed approach. It provides a comprehensive exploration of the issues surrounding the adoption of glamourised street lifestyles and highlights the genuine consequences of these choices. The session examines the realities of knife crime, criminal exploitation, joint enterprise, and the false perceptions that make negative lifestyles appear exciting or rewarding. It also addresses the powerful influence of social media on youth attitudes and behaviour, while promoting positive aspirations, personal accountability, and the importance of making informed and constructive choices.
Targeted Whole School Support

School Support Programmes
Street Whyze offers targeted school support programmes designed to address key themes such as misogyny, bullying, conflict management, and racism. In addition, the organisation provides a seclusion, reflection, and reset support package, which combines reflective and restorative practices to enhance relational approaches within schools. These programmes also include the delivery of Continuing Professional Development (CPD) sessions for staff, supporting schools to create safer, more inclusive, and positive learning environments.
